درواقع به تقسیم ترافیک شبکه بین سرورهای موجود، Load Balancing میگویند. برای اینکه بتوانید مفهوم Load Balancing در شبکه را بهتر درک کنید تنها کافیست که به این مثال توجه کنید. فرض کنید که وارد بانک شدهاید، همانطور که میدانید هر یک از کارمندان بانک در یک گیشه قرار میگیرند تا کارهای بانکی ارباب رجوعها را انجام دهند از اینرو کارهای بانکی افراد بین کارمندان بانک تقسیم میشود و روند رسیدگی به کارهای بانکی افراد سرعت میگیرد. حالا فرض کنید که بانک تنها یک کارمند داشت چه اتفاقی میافتاد؟ شما مجبور بودید ساعتها در صف بمانید تا بالاخره نوبت انجام کار بانکی شما بشود.
درواقع سایتهای پربازدید نیز مانند بانک هستند درصورتی که تنها یک سرور داشته باشند سرعت پاسخگویی به درخواستها به صورت چشمگیری کاهش پیدا میکند. از اینرو است که سایتهای پربازدید از چندین سرور برخوردارند و از تکنولوژی Load Balancing جهت تقسیم ترافیک بین سرورها استفاده میکنند. هدف Load balancing از تقسیم ترافیک شبکه بین سرورها به صورت کاملا مساوی، افزایش سرعت جهت پاسخ به درخواستها است. از این جهت روی هیچ سروری بار پردازشی بیش از حد مجاز اعمال نمیشود. البته تمامی سایتها از لود بالانسینگ استفاده نمیکنند چراکه تنها برخی از وب سایتها به دلیل حجم بالای بازدیدهایی که دارند از چندین سرور برخوردارند و از این تکنولوژی استفاده میکنند.
Load balancer چیست؟
جهت استفاده از تکنولوژی Load balancing به یک دستگاه Load balancer در شبکه نیاز است. درواقع دستگاه Load balancer به عنوان واسط، بین کلاینت و سرور قرار میگیرد. از اینرو تمامی ترافیک ورودی در شبکه ابتدا وارد Load balancer میشود و سپس توسط این دستگاه به صورت مساوی بین تمامی سرورها تقسیم میگردد تا سرعت پاسخگویی به درخواستها افزایش پیدا کند. یکی از مهمترین مزایا و ویژگیهای تکنولوژی Load balancing این است که شما میتوانید بدون داشتن کوچکترین Down time یک سرور جدید به شبکه خود اضافه کنید تا به صورت خودکار درخواستها و ترافیک ورودی بر روی آن نیز توضیع گردد.
چند نوع Load Balancing در شبکه وجود دارد؟
Load Balancing L4
یکی از انواع لود بالانسینگ در شبکه، Load balancing L4 است که برای توزیع ترافیک در شبکه از پروتکلهای لایه چهارم استفاده میکند. به گونهای که جهت تقسیم کردن ترافیک بین سرورها از آدرس IP و پورتهای TCP استفاده میکند.
Load Balancing L7
این نوع لود بالانسینگ نیز همانطور که از نامش پیداست برای توزیع ترافیک در شبکه از پروتکلهای لایه هفتم استفاده میکند اما نسبت به Load balancing L4 قدرتمندتر و پیشرفتهتر است.
Global Server Load Balancing یا GSLB
و اما قدرتمندترین و پیشرفتهترین نوع Load balancing، GSLB است. این نوع لود بالانسینگ به این دلیل قدرتمندترین نوع این تکنولوژی محسوب میشود که برای توزیع ترافیک شبکه بین سرورها از ترکیب پروتکلهای لایه چهارم و لایه هفتم شبکه استفاده میکند.
مرکز طراحی شبکه متشکل از بخشهای متعددی است که از پیشرفتهترین و بروزترین تکنولوژیهای روز دنیا برخوردار هستند. این مرکز از کارشناسان متخصص و خبرهای برخوردار است که دانش و مهارت بالایی در زمینه انواع شبکهها و نحوه پیادهسازی آنها دارند از اینرو سرویسهایی شامل: طراحی و اجرای انواع سیستمهای شبکه، رفع مشکلات انواع شبکهها، نصب و پیادهسازی انواع تجهیزات شبکه و … را به صورت کاملا حرفهای و تخصصی به کاربران ارائه میدهند.